Make sure you are aware of the safety features on the cot made of wood before you purchase. For instance, the gap between the bars must not exceed 6.5cm or more, and there is a risk of babies getting their limbs trapped. Make sure the cot is in compliance with the safety standard BSEN 716-1:2008+A1:2013.
